Peanut Butter Banana Bread

serves 8 - 10

Ingredients

  • 3 over ripe bananas, mashed
  • 1/2 cup creamy natural peanut butter
  • 1/2 cup + 2 tbsp. brown sugar, divided
  • 1/4 cup unflavored soy or almond milk
  • 1 tsp. vanilla extract
  • 1 1/2 cups spelt flour (could sub all purpose)
  • 1 tsp. baking soda
  • 1/2 tsp. salt
  • 1 cup roasted and salted peanuts

Details

Preparation time 10mins
Cooking time 60mins
Adapted from connoisseurusveg.com

Preparation

Step 1

1.Preheat oven to 350º. Grease a 9 inch loaf pan.
2.In large mixing bowl, stir together bananas, peanut butter and ½ cup brown sugar. Add milk and vanilla. Stir until well blended.
3.In separate bowl, stir together flour, baking soda, and salt. Add to banana mixture and stir just until blended, being careful not to over blend. Fold in peanuts.
4.Pour batter into prepared loaf pan. Sprinkle with remaining 2 tablespoons of brown sugar. Bake until lightly browned on top, 50 minutes.
5.Transfer to cooling rack and allow to cool before removing from pan.
